The Role of Design in Building Connection

Design has a strong part in how people act in a room. Where seats are placed, how, and even the smell, all change how people feel and take part in something. Smart designers see this, and they make plans that help both people who want to be alone and those who like to be with others.

  • Open layouts help people talk together and feel more energy in the room.
  • Cozy corners give comfort for small and close talks.
  • Sensory elements like music and lighting make the place feel warm.
  • Flexible spaces let you change things, so you can use them for groups or shows.

These design ideas help to make social places feel alive. People feel welcome when they walk in and also feel inspired to join in and take part.
